Increased urine frequency, also known as polyuria, refers to the need to urinate more frequently than normal, often accompanied by a larger volume of urine output. This condition can be both bothersome and disruptive to daily life. Increased urine frequency can result from a range of causes. One common cause is diabetes mellitus, where high blood sugar levels lead to excess glucose in the urine, drawing more water into the urine and increasing its volume. Similarly, uncontrolled diabetes insipidus, a condition characterized by a deficiency of antidiuretic hormone or a lack of kidney response to it, can cause excessive urine production. Other causes include urinary tract infections (UTIs), which can irritate the bladder and increase the urge to urinate. Diuretic medications, often prescribed for hypertension or edema, can also lead to increased urine output. Additionally, conditions such as overactive bladder syndrome, where the bladder muscle contracts more frequently than normal, can result in frequent urination.
Treatment for increased urine frequency depends on the underlying cause. For diabetes, managing blood glucose levels through medication, lifestyle changes, and dietary adjustments can help reduce polyuria. In cases of diabetes insipidus, treatment may involve hormone replacement therapy or medications that reduce urine production. For UTIs, antibiotics are prescribed to clear the infection and alleviate symptoms. If diuretics are the cause, a healthcare provider may adjust the dosage or prescribe alternative medications. For overactive bladder syndrome, treatment may include lifestyle modifications, bladder training exercises, and medications such as anticholinergics or beta-3 agonists that help relax the bladder. It is important to consult with a healthcare provider for an accurate diagnosis and appropriate treatment plan tailored to the specific cause of increased urine frequency.
